Wattmeter is an intrument which is used to measure the power consumption of an Electric circuit or an appliance which is connected to the supply in terms of Watts.
The advantages of wattmeter include adequate for low frequencies, easy to operate and better technology. There are different types of wattmeter and each has specific advantages.

Blondel's Theorem states that you can have one less wattmeter than there are conductors supplying a balanced or unbalanced load. In either case, the sum of the wattmeter readings will give you the total power of the load.
